Background
Most of the bean products are bean curd formed by coagulating soybean milk of soybeans and remade products thereof, and pulping equipment is required in the production of the bean products. The existing refining equipment has the following problems:
1. the soybean milk in the pulping tank needs to be poured out after the pulping equipment grinds the soybean products so as to facilitate the production and manufacturing of the next procedure of the soybean products, the existing pulping equipment is inconvenient to pour out the soybean milk, the time is wasted, and the production efficiency is reduced.
2. The long-time use of defibrination blade needs to be changed in order to better defibrination among the existing defibrination equipment, and the time of extravagant staff is changed to current blade, can not carry out quick replacement, reduces work efficiency.

Examples
Referring to fig. 1-3, the present invention provides the following technical solutions: an automatic pulping device for bean product processing comprises a placing plate 1 and a pulping device 2, wherein the top of the placing plate 1 is fixedly connected with a supporting rod 3, the outer surface of the pulping device 2 is fixedly connected with a connecting block 4, the supporting rod 3 is rotatably connected with the connecting block 4, the top of the placing plate 1 is provided with an adjusting groove 5, an adjusting screw 6 is rotatably connected between the inner walls of the adjusting groove 5, the outer surface of the adjusting screw 6 is in threaded connection with an adjusting block 7, the top of the adjusting block 7 is rotatably connected with an adjusting plate 8, one end of the adjusting plate 8 is rotatably connected with the bottom of the pulping device 2, one end of the adjusting screw 6 penetrates and extends to one side of the placing plate 1 and is fixedly connected with an adjusting disc 9, one side of the adjusting disc 9 is fixedly connected with an adjusting rod 10, the top of the placing plate 1 is fixedly connected with a U-shaped plate 11, the top of the U-shaped plate 11 is fixedly connected with a control box 12, and the top of the control box 12 is communicated with a discharging hopper 17, the front fixedly connected with slide 20 of control box 12, the discharge hole 21 has been seted up in the front of control box 12, the top fixedly connected with water pump 13 of U-shaped plate 11, the input tube intercommunication of water pump 13 has water pipe 15, places the top fixedly connected with water tank 14 of board 1, the top of water tank 14 and the one end intercommunication of water pipe 15.
In this embodiment, cooperate through adjusting screw 6, regulating block 7, regulating plate 8, adjustment disk 9 and regulation pole 10, realize 2 inclination's of defibrinator adjustment, be convenient for empty the soybean milk in the defibrinator 2, save manual work and operating time, improve work efficiency, the implementation is swift, has increased the practicality, solves current pulping equipment and is not convenient for pour the soybean milk, and waste time reduces production efficiency's problem.
Specifically, a baffle 18 is slidably connected to one side of the control box 12, and a pull ring 19 is fixedly connected to one side of the baffle 18.
In this embodiment, the soybeans in the discharge hopper 17 are quantitatively fed into the soybean milk grinder 2 through the baffle 18, the feeding amount of the soybeans is ensured, and the pull ring 19 is convenient for moving the baffle 18.
Specifically, the bottom fixed mounting of pulp grinder 2 has motor 22, the output of motor 22 runs through and extends to inner diapire one side and fixedly connected with thread bush 23 of pulp grinder 2, the inner wall threaded connection of thread bush 23 has threaded rod 24, the top fixedly connected with blade disc 25 of threaded rod 24, T-slot 26 has been seted up at the top of blade disc 25, the inner wall sliding connection of T-slot 26 has T-shaped piece 27, one side fixedly connected with connecting plate 28 of T-shaped piece 27, one side fixedly connected with of connecting plate 28 grinds thick liquid cutter 29.
In this embodiment, can carry out quick assembly disassembly to blade disc 25 through thread bush 23 and 24 threaded connection of threaded rod, utilize T-shaped piece 27 and T-shaped groove 26 sliding connection, can carry out quick replacement to thick liquid cutter 29, be convenient for grind quick maintenance behind the cutter 29 damage, save the time of maintenance, solve the time of the extravagant staff of current blade change, can not carry out quick replacement, reduce work efficiency's problem.
Specifically, the output end of the water pump 13 is communicated with a control valve 16.
In this embodiment, the control valve 16 can control the amount of water flowing into the soybean milk grinder 2, so as to ensure the accuracy of the amount of water of soybean milk and prevent the bean products from being manufactured with defective products due to excessive water.
Specifically, the top of the slide way 20 is fixedly connected with a guide plate, and the position of the guide plate is distributed on two sides of the slide way 20.
In this embodiment, the guide board is injectd the direction of rolling of soybean, prevents that the soybean from rolling from the both sides of slide 20, leads to the soybean to scatter.
Specifically, the material of the pulp grinder 2 is stainless steel.
In this embodiment, the stainless steel has chemical corrosion resistance, electrochemical corrosion resistance, heat resistance, high temperature resistance, low temperature resistance, and ultra-low temperature resistance, and can prolong the service life of the refiner 2.
The utility model discloses a theory of operation and use flow: when soybeans in a pulping device 2 are ground into soybean milk and need to be dumped, an adjusting rod 10 is rotated, the adjusting rod 10 drives an adjusting disc 9 to rotate, the adjusting disc 9 drives an adjusting screw 6 to rotate, the adjusting screw 6 drives an adjusting block 7 to move, the adjusting block 7 drives an adjusting plate 8 to move, the adjusting plate 8 drives the pulping device 2 to dump, when the adjusting plate 8 moves to a certain position, the soybean milk in the pulping device 2 is dumped out, the adjusting rod 10 is rotated reversely, the pulping device 2 recovers to the original position, when a pulping cutter 29 is damaged, the T-shaped block 27 is in sliding connection with a T-shaped groove 26, the pulping cutter 29 is taken out for replacement, when the cutter 25 is damaged, the cutter 25 directly rotates the cutter 25, the cutter 25 drives a threaded rod 24 to rotate, the threaded rod 24 is separated from a threaded sleeve 23, the cutter 25 is replaced, then a pull ring 19 is pulled, the pull ring 19 drives a baffle 18 to move, when the baffle 18 moves to a certain position, the soybeans in a blanking hopper 17 enter the pulping device 2, the control valve 16 is opened, the water pump 13 is started, water in the water tank 14 is sent into the refiner 2, when a certain amount of water is obtained, the control valve 16 is closed and the baffle 18 is restored to the original position, the motor 22 is started, and the output end of the motor 22 carries the refining cutter 29 to carry out refining.
